GENERAL DESCRIPTION
The ADR293 is a low noise, micropower precision voltage reference that utilizes an XFET® (eXtra implanted junction FET) reference circuit. The XFET architecture offers significant performance improvements over traditional band gap and buried Zener-based references. Improvements include one quarter the voltage noise output of band gap references operating at the same current, very low and ultralinear temperature drift, low thermal hysteresis, and excellent long term stability.

FEATURES
6.0 V to 15 V supply range
Supply current: 15 μA maximum
Low noise: 15 μV p-p typical (0.1 Hz to 10 Hz)
High output current: 5 mA
Temperature range: −40°C to +125°C
Pin-compatible with the REF02/REF19x

APPLICATIONS
Portable instrumentation
Precision reference for 5 V systems
ADC and DAC reference
Solar-powered applications
Loop-current powered instruments
